A cyclist rode for 3.5 hours and completed a distance of 60.9 miles, if she kept the same average speed for each hour, how far did she ride in 1 hour

Estimate the quotient. Include the equation to show your work. Explain your thinking

To find the distance the cyclist rode in one hour, we can divide the total distance of 60.9 miles by the total time of 3.5 hours.

Distance in 1 hour = Total distance / Total time

Distance in 1 hour = 60.9 miles / 3.5 hours

Using a calculator, we can find:

Distance in 1 hour ≈ 17.4 miles

Therefore, the cyclist rode approximately 17.4 miles in one hour.
